Cherry-Almond Snack Mix
 
Source: dLife

Oat cereal, almonds, and dried cherries come together to form a delicious snack that you can keep for up to a week.

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 20 minutes
Difficulty: EASY

Nutrition Facts

Makes 20 servings
Serving Size: 0.25 cup
Amount Per Serving
Calories 79.6
Total Carbs 14.1 g
Dietary Fiber 1.5 g
Sugars 5.2 g
Total Fat 1.9 g
Saturated Fat 0.8 g
Unsaturated Fat 1 g
Potassium 45 mg
Protein 1.8 g
Sodium 69.6 mg
Dietary Exchanges
1/4 Fat, 1/4 Fruit, 1/2 Starch

Ingredients
4 cup oatmeal squares cereal
0.5 cup sliced almonds
2 tbsp butter , melted
0.5 tsp apple pie spice
1 pinch salt
1 cup dried cherries


Directions
1 Preheat the oven to 300 degrees F. In a 15x10x1-inch baking pan, combine the cereal and almonds.
2 Stir together the melted butter, the apple pie spice, and the salt in a small bowl, and then drizzle the butter mixture over the cereal mixture. Toss to evenly coat the mixture.
3 Bake for about 20 minutes or until the almonds are toasted, stirring once during baking.
4 Cool in the pan on a wire rack for 20 minutes, and then stir in dried cherries and/or golden raisins.
5 Cool completely, and then store in a tightly covered container at room temperature for up to 1 week.
